The graduating students of the College of Maritime Education underwent an onboard training orientation held at the JBL Hall last April 20. 

This orientation is a critical requirement for all graduating BSMT III students, both regular and irregular, as well as their parents or guardians. The topics covered were for them to better understand the processes and preparations needed before going onboard.

The discussions covered vital technical topics, including the management of the Training Record Book (TRB), daily journal duties for bridge watchkeeping, and the use of the JCADETS monitoring application.

Capt. Jason June Almonte, Shipboard Training Supervisor, did a comprehensive briefing of onboard processes and requirements. The key speakers, 2/M Jan Patrick Miraflores and 2/M Eazyll Faith M. Siwagan, provided guidance on social media etiquette and onboard training guidance (OTG) to ensure professional conduct at sea.
